Karen, originally from Massachusetts, has made Atlanta her home for many years. She holds a Bachelor of Science in Education from Framingham State University and a Master of Education in Early Childhood from Georgia State University. With 38 years of experience in education, Karen retired from the Clayton County Public School System in 2015. Throughout her tenure, she held various roles including classroom teacher for third, fourth, and fifth grades, participation in the Early Intervention Program, literacy and math coaching, instructional site facilitation, and curriculum development for language arts, math, and social studies.Additionally, Karen coordinated a yearly Math & Science Summer Camp, facilitated a Math Competition, and supervised Clayton County’s Summer School program before retiring.

For the past eight years, she has been a vital resource and supporter with Path to Shine. She has been a mentor with Path To Shine, assists in mentor training, and serves as a Site Liaison for four Path To Shine sites.
